Understanding Varicose Veins
Varicose veins take place when veins end up being bigger or swollen due to malfunctioning valves. Typically appearing as blue or dark purple bulges on the legs, they can result in pain or more serious complications if left unattended. Types of Varicose Vein Elimination Procedures
Sclerotherapy: A Non-Surgical Approach
Sclerotherapy involves injecting an option into the affected veins, triggering them to collapse and fade in time. It's usually suggested for smaller sized varicose veins and spider veins.
Laser Treatments: Advanced Technology
Laser therapy utilizes focused light energy to target particular locations of the vein without harming surrounding tissue. This technique is less intrusive and frequently needs minimal downtime.
Endovenous Laser Treatment (EVLT)
EVLT is a minimally intrusive procedure where laser energy is used inside the vein. It's progressively popular due to its efficiency and rapid healing time compared to traditional surgical methods.

FAQs About Varicose Vein Removal
1. What triggers varicose veins?
Varicose veins are mainly caused by weakened valves in the veins, resulting in bad blood flow back towards the heart.

2. How do I understand if I require varicose vein removal?
If you're experiencing discomfort, swelling, or visible bulging veins that affect your lifestyle or lead to discomfort, speak with a vein professional who can suggest suitable treatment alternatives based on your condition.
3. Are there threats associated with varicose vein removal?
As with any medical procedure, threats consist of bleeding, infection, or allergies however are usually low when carried out by skilled specialists at respectable clinics.
4. How long does recovery take after varicose vein removal?
Recovery times differ depending upon the kind of treatment but most clients go back to regular activities within a week while sticking closely to aftercare guidelines supplied by their doctors.
